Who you are:

As an Associate, you will collaborate on a daily basis with the team’s business, expanding your knowledge in all aspects of commercial sales and financing that will allow you to develop a unique combination of financial and research skills. You will be performing financial analysis and other analytical work to support capital markets transactions. You will serve as a liaison with clients and lenders and assist clients in conducting research, performing analysis of budgets, expenses and historical operating information. You will request and consolidate due diligence materials and support other team members with preparing offering memorandums, broker opinion of values, and other proposals. As a dedicated member of the capital markets team, you will be responsible for processing deal transactions, updating databases, consolidating marketing and due diligence materials and supporting deal production.

 

What you bring:

·        Bachelor's degree in Finance, Business Administration, Accounting, Economics or related area

·        Quality internship or applicable background with 1+ years of experience in Commercial Real Estate, Finance, or related area

·        Understanding of the real estate industry, terminology and documentation or other related sales experience

·        Exceptional quantitative, writing and communication skills

·        Advanced technical financial analysis and computer skills, including high proficiency in Microsoft Office (Outlook, Word, PowerPoint and Excel)

·        Strong understanding of CRE valuation principles such as: NPV, Income Capitalization, & IRR

·        Ability to assist with deals by preparing /reviewing presentations, reports, proposals, spreadsheets, correspondence and other documents.

·        Ability to deliver excellent customer service at all levels of the organization and with external partners through clear and concise oral/written communication

·        Ability to meet deadlines without compromising accuracy, product quality and attention to detail
